I was waiting to snap the Voyager but the waiting passengers were in fact more interesting than the train. A columnist in 'Rail' magazine asked, recently, why the position of each coach can't be announced by the station PA system, so if you have a reservation for seat 23 in coach B you would know roughly where to stand. This would probably lead to more reserved seats actually being used by the relevant ticket-holder. A lot of people, it is suspected, drop into the first suitable vacant seat rather than go up and down the train looking for the seat that has been reserved for them. Other passengers, without reservations can be left searching for un-reserved seats, despite there being empty reserved seats whose reservers have plonked themselves elsewhere.
